Clydesdale Complete Season With Victory

There was a fitting finale at Brands Hatch for Clydesdale Bank, which brought the chequered flag down on the third year of its sponsorship deal with British Touring Car Championship outfit Team Halfords.

In the final round of the 2008 HiQ MSA British Touring Car Championship at the Brands Hatch circuit in Kent, driver Tom Chilton dominated the race to take first place for Team Halfords.

Chilton’s Honda Civic was first home ahead of Motorbase BMW driver Steven Kane and Vauxhall’s Tom Onslow-Cole and cemented 10th place in the overall championship for the 23-year-old driver.

Adrian Wenn, Clydesdale Bank’s Regional Director (Southern), said: “Over the past three years, we have thoroughly, enjoyed supporting the British Touring Car Championships. The partnership has helped us raise our profile nationally and particularly in the south and in turn we have been delighted to support such a vibrant and exciting branch of motorsport.

“It was fitting finale that Tom stormed to victory in the final race of this season and it was great that it took place at such a world-renowned racing venue as Brands Hatch.”
